REDKEN for Roberto Cavalli NYFW SS15

ROBERTO CAVALLI
Spring/Summer 2015

Hair by Guido, Redken Global Styling Director

Redken Global Styling Director Guido created rich, natural hairstyle for Roberto Cavalli’s Spring/Summer 2015 show in Milan. To achieve this fresh-from-the-salon look, Guido used Pillow Proof Blow Dry express primer and satinwear 02 prepping blow-dry lotion to blow-dry the hair smooth, but leaving the length natural for a rich, luxurious finish.

“It’s a very simple, minimal hairstyle at Cavalli this season, with a very rich feeling, almost like the girls just stepped out of the salon. I used satinwear 02 to blow-dry the hair smooth and then created a sort-of messy middle party with my fingers. After creating the part, I didn’t touch the hair again, so it feels very natural and luxurious with a little bit of sexiness.”

Guido, Redken Global Styling Director

Redken Products Used:
Pillow Proof Blow Dry express primer. Rek price SEK 295
satinwear 02 prepping blow-dry lotion. Rek price SEK 295

Create the Look:

1. Thoroughly mist Pillow Proof Blow Dry express primer all over damp hair and comb through.

2. Apply a nicked-size amount of satinwear 02 prepping blow-dry lotion throughout damp hair and blowdry smooth with a round brush.

3. Create a center part with fingers, leaving the length of the hair natural.
